In what ways can a wire mesh floor increase the durability of a beehive? Extend Your Hive's Lifespan Effectively


A wire mesh floor acts as a critical preservation system for your beehive. It increases durability primarily by generating airflow that prevents moisture buildup, thereby stopping the wooden components from rotting or warping. Additionally, the mesh itself is constructed from robust metals like stainless or galvanized steel, offering superior resistance to physical wear, pests, and disease compared to solid wood floors.

Core Takeaway The longevity of a wooden beehive is most threatened by trapped moisture and organic decay. A wire mesh floor solves this by creating a "breathable" foundation that actively vents humidity, preserving the structural integrity of the wood while providing a corrosion-resistant barrier against pests.

Combating Moisture and Wood Decay

The most significant threat to a beehive’s lifespan is not external weather, but internal condensation. A wire mesh floor addresses the root causes of wood deterioration.

Eliminating Standing Moisture

Bees generate significant heat and humidity. In a solid-floor hive, this moisture condenses on the walls and floor, creating a damp environment.

Wire mesh facilitates constant vertical airflow, allowing moisture to drain and evaporate instantly. By keeping the interior dry, you effectively neutralize the conditions required for mold and fungus to grow.

Preventing Structural Warping

Wood is hygroscopic; it swells when wet and shrinks when dry. Constant fluctuations in internal humidity cause wooden hive parts to warp, twist, and crack over time.

By stabilizing the humidity levels through ventilation, wire mesh ensures the wooden components maintain their shape, ensuring tight seals and structural rigidity for years longer than a damp hive.

Material Robustness and Physical Protection

Beyond protecting the wood, the floor itself is a high-wear component. Replacing wood with metal mesh introduces a higher standard of material durability.

Resistance to Biological Threats

Wooden floors are susceptible to scratching, gnawing by pests, and absorption of disease-carrying biological matter.

Because the mesh is made of metal, it is inherently resistant to most bee diseases and pests. It provides a barrier that cannot be easily breached or degraded by biological activity, protecting the hive from the "wear and tear" of active colony life.

Corrosion Resistance

Modern wire mesh floors are typically fabricated from stainless, galvanized, or black epoxy steel.

These materials are engineered to withstand the acidic environment of a hive and exposure to the elements without rusting. This ensures the floor mechanism itself remains functional and secure without frequent replacement.

The Impact of Hygiene on Structure

Durability is also a function of cleanliness. Debris accumulation accelerates decay.

Reducing Organic Buildup

Dead bees, wax cappings, and pollen dropped on a solid floor act as a sponge for moisture, pressing wet rot against the bottom board.

Wire mesh allows small debris and Varroa mites to fall through the hive completely. This self-cleaning action prevents the accumulation of rotting organic material inside the hive, removing a primary catalyst for floor decay.

Understanding the Trade-offs

While wire mesh significantly aids durability, it requires correct implementation to ensure it does not introduce new problems.

Material Selection Matters

Not all mesh is created equal. Using non-galvanized or cheap metal can lead to rust, which compromises the mesh strength and can contaminate the hive. Stainless steel is the gold standard for maximum longevity.

Winter Management

While airflow prevents rot, excessive drafts in freezing climates can stress the colony. Most mesh floors utilize a removable insert or bottom board. Durability is maximized when this board is used strategically—removed for ventilation in summer and inserted to reduce drafts (while still allowing drainage) in winter.
